It’s Time to Give Up
by Troy McLaughlin
The great thing about writing is you can edit, you can take out the bad parts, polish and make it better. In essence you can make it like a new car, shiny and clean. The problem is that’s what we try to do with our lives. Tidy them up, make them presentable, and show that we are not broken inside. While under the hood, inside we’re broken. The best we do is cover up the broken parts. At best, we are just polishing the outside.
The catch is, we can’t fix or heal ourselves, no one can.
In all the fixing we get tired, walk away, or get so discouraged we quit on ourselves and many times, God. It’s a 24 hour proposition we can’t, and will never handle. You know what God says to us;” I’ve got this handled.” “Let’s hangout.” “I love you.” “The fix is on me.” “I’m the only one who can give you rest, and it’s only found in me, not in a career, job, thing, possessions, relationship, nothing will fix you, except me, period.”
So it’s time to give up and give in to what only God can do, fix you and give your soul true rest. Are you going to join me as you face this reality? Are you going to give up, and give in to God, for His rest and His job in fixing you? Yes it goes against all the experts voices, to say don’t give up or give in, well on this one it’s the only answer that works.
Matt 28-30 MSG “Are you tired? Worn out? Burned out on religion? Come to me. Get away with me and you’ll recover your life. I’ll show you how to take a real rest. Walk with me and work with me—watch how I do it. Learn the unforced rhythms of grace. I won’t lay anything heavy or ill-fitting on you. Keep company with me and you’ll learn to live freely and lightly.”
God’s the one waiting and wanting you to give up, and give into Him. The magnificent thing is, He will always be there, and He never ever gives up on you. He always wants you. In fact, He can’t love you more, whether you’re fixed, or broken. Nothing, I repeat nothing, you’ve ever done, will do, or say will ever make God love or want you more.
As you face this week and the voices creep in “you’re not enough, you need fixing,” rest assured that God is with you, for you, and wants you, no conditions or strings attached.
